About Takeshi Masuda
Takeshi Masuda is a scholar working on Neurology, Spectroscopy and Biochemistry, having authored 113 papers that have together received 3.2k indexed citations. Recurring topics across this work include Advanced Proteomics Techniques and Applications (18 papers), Orthopaedic implants and arthroplasty (15 papers), Mass Spectrometry Techniques and Applications (14 papers), Hip disorders and treatments (12 papers), Metabolomics and Mass Spectrometry Studies (11 papers), Total Knee Arthroplasty Outcomes (10 papers), Spine and Intervertebral Disc Pathology (9 papers) and Barrier Structure and Function Studies (9 papers). The work is most often cited by research in Spectroscopy (721 citations), Molecular Biology (1.8k citations) and Genetics (217 citations). Takeshi Masuda has collaborated with scholars based in Japan, United States and France. Frequent co-authors include Yasushi Ishihama, Masaru Tomita, Naoyuki Sugiyama, Sumio Ohtsuki, Kosaku Shinoda, Takahiko Hyakumachi, Yasushi Yanagibashi, Akihiro Nakamura, Shigenobu Sato and Hisashi Yoshimoto. Their work appears in journals such as Science, Nucleic Acids Research and Journal of Biological Chemistry.
